
Nigerian Government Misses Q1 Tax Target by N2.2 Trillion
The Nigerian Federal Government has reportedly missed its first-quarter tax revenue target by a significant N2.2 trillion. This shortfall highlights challenges in the nation's fiscal performance for the period.

The Nigerian military said Tuesday that joint airstrikes it launched with US forces at the weekend have killed 175 jihadists from the Islamic State group in Nigeria, including the group's global second-in -command.

Nigeria’s military on Tuesday said that joint airstrikes with the United States had killed 175 Islamic State (IS) fighters in the country’s northeast, including the militant group’s global second-in-command. The remote region has been gripped by an extremist insurgency since 2009, first by Boko Haram, then its offshoot and rival, the Islamic State West Africa Province (ISWAP). Nigeria’s Q1 tax revenue fell N2.24tn short of its target amid new tax reforms. The Nigeria Revenue Service generated N7.44tn against a N9.68tn goal. Read More: https://punchng.com/fg-misses-q1-tax-target-by-n2-2tn-2/
